Benefits of Black tea

Black tea provides many health benefits to the body, the most important of which are the following:

  • It has antioxidant properties, because it contains antioxidant polyphenols, which reduce cell damage caused by free radicals.
  • It can promote heart health, because it contains flavonoids, which reduce the risk of heart disease.
  • It can reduce bad cholesterol levels , which may contribute to reducing the risk of heart disease and strokes.
  • Promotes digestive health, due to its polyphenol content that has antimicrobial properties, which promote gut and immune health.
